The DPP4 gene encodes dipeptidyl peptidase 4 which is identical to adenosine deaminase complexing protein-2 and to the T-cell activation antigen CD26 It is an intrinsic type II transmembrane glycoprotein and a serine exopeptidase that cleaves X-proline dipeptides from the N-terminus of polypeptides Dipeptidyl peptidase 4 is highly involved in glucose and insulin metabolism as well as in immune regulation This protein was shown to be a functional receptor for Middle East respiratory syndrome coronavirus (MERS-CoV) and protein modeling suggests that it may play a similar role with SARS-CoV-2 the virus responsible for COVID-19
